В мире, где объемы данных растут с каждой секундой, специалисты, способные управлять и извлекать ценность из этого бесконечного потока информации, становятся ключевыми игроками в любой отрасли. Hadoop, как один из ведущих инструментов для работы с "большими данными", открывает новые горизонты для тех, кто готов взять на себя роль архитектора данных. В этой статье мы погрузимся в мир Hadoop-разработчиков, востребованных на платформе Hired — месте, где великие умы встречаются с большими данными, чтобы вместе творить технологические чудеса. Присоединяйтесь к нам в путешествии по миру, где каждый байт информации имеет свою ценность, а каждый разработчик может стать ключевым звеном в механизме прогресса.
Оглавление
- Востребованность разработчиков Hadoop на платформе Hired
- Путь к мастерству: ключевые навыки для Hadoop-разработчика
- Секреты успешного резюме для Hadoop-специалиста
- Проекты с Big Data: как Hadoop меняет правила игры
- Интервью с экспертом: что ждут работодатели от Hadoop-разработчиков
- Карьерный рост в сфере Big Data: перспективы и возможности
- Советы по подготовке к собеседованию для работы с Hadoop
- Вопрос/ответ
- Вывод
Востребованность разработчиков Hadoop на платформе Hired
С каждым годом мир данных становится всё более объёмным и сложным, а специалисты, способные работать с большими данными, особенно с использованием экосистемы Hadoop, пользуются все большим спросом. Платформа Hired, известная своими возможностями для поиска работы в сфере IT, подтверждает этот тренд. Разработчики Hadoop здесь находятся в числе наиболее востребованных профессионалов, что обусловлено несколькими ключевыми факторами:
- Рост объемов данных: Компании всех масштабов сталкиваются с необходимостью обработки и анализа огромных массивов информации.
- Необходимость в эффективном хранении: Hadoop позволяет эффективно хранить данные благодаря своей распределенной файловой системе (HDFS).
- Сложность задач: Разработчики должны уметь не только работать с данными, но и оптимизировать процессы их обработки.
Анализируя статистику платформы Hired, можно увидеть, что спрос на разработчиков Hadoop растет с каждым кварталом. Для наглядности представим данные в виде таблицы, демонстрирующей динамику вакансий за последний год:
Квартал | Количество вакансий | Изменение по сравнению с предыдущим кварталом |
---|---|---|
Q1 2022 | 120 | — |
Q2 2022 | 150 | +25% |
Q3 2022 | 180 | +20% |
Q4 2022 | 210 | +16.7% |
Такие показатели являются отражением не только растущего интереса к специалистам в данной области, но и повышения их ценности на рынке труда. Разработчики Hadoop, владеющие навыками работы с большими данными, могут рассчитывать на привлекательные предложения от работодателей, стремящихся использовать данные для повышения эффективности своего бизнеса.
Путь к мастерству: ключевые навыки для Hadoop-разработчика
Становление профессиональным Hadoop-разработчиком требует освоения ряда ключевых навыков, которые позволят эффективно работать с огромными объемами данных. В первую очередь, необходимо глубокое понимание экосистемы Hadoop, включая основные компоненты, такие как HDFS, MapReduce, Hive и Pig. Кроме того, важно уметь работать с YARN, который помогает управлять ресурсами кластера, и Zookeeper для координации распределенных приложений.
Дополнительно, разработчику необходимо владеть навыками программирования на Java, поскольку большинство Hadoop-приложений и инструментов написаны на этом языке. Знание SQL и опыт работы с базами данных также критичны, так как они позволяют эффективно обрабатывать и анализировать данные. Ниже представлен список ключевых навыков, которые помогут вам стать востребованным специалистом в области Big Data:
- Понимание принципов распределенных систем и способность работать с ними
- Профессиональное владение Java, а также знакомство с другими языками, такими как Scala или Python
- Опыт работы с базами данных и знание SQL
- Умение работать с Linux/Unix системами, поскольку Hadoop часто используется в этих средах
- Знание инструментов для автоматизации развертывания, таких как Docker и Kubernetes
Навык | Описание | Важность |
Экосистема Hadoop | Глубокое понимание HDFS, MapReduce и других компонентов | Высокая |
Java | Основной язык для разработки в Hadoop | Высокая |
SQL и базы данных | Умение обрабатывать и анализировать данные | Средняя |
Linux/Unix | Способность работать в предпочтительных средах для Hadoop | Средняя |
Автоматизация развертывания | Знание Docker, Kubernetes для эффективного масштабирования | Средняя |
Секреты успешного резюме для Hadoop-специалиста
Чтобы выделиться на рынке труда как Hadoop-специалист, необходимо создать резюме, которое продемонстрирует не только ваш технический опыт, но и способность применять его для решения сложных задач. Вот несколько ключевых моментов, которые помогут вам в этом:
- Подчеркните свои технические навыки: Укажите все технологии Hadoop экосистемы, с которыми вы работали, включая HDFS, MapReduce, Hive, Pig, HBase и другие. Не забудьте также описать ваш опыт с программированием на Java, Python или Scala, а также использование SQL.
- Примеры проектов: Опишите конкретные проекты, в которых вы участвовали, и вашу роль в них. Укажите, какие задачи вы решали, какие инструменты использовали и какой был результат. Это покажет потенциальным работодателям вашу способность применять знания на практике.
Кроме того, важно продемонстрировать, что вы не только технически подкованный специалист, но и обладаете навыками, необходимыми для работы в команде и ведения проектов:
Навык | Описание |
---|---|
Коммуникативные навыки | Опишите, как вы взаимодействовали с командой и стейкхолдерами, а также какие методы коммуникации использовали для эффективного обмена информацией. |
Управление проектами | Приведите примеры, когда вы брали на себя ответственность за планирование и выполнение проектов, включая сроки и ресурсы. |
Решение проблем | Расскажите о сложных задачах, с которыми вы сталкивались, и о том, как вы находили инновационные решения для их преодоления. |
Не забывайте регулярно обновлять свое резюме, добавляя новые навыки и проекты. Это покажет ваше стремление к развитию и обучению, что ценится в динамично развивающейся сфере Big Data.
Проекты с Big Data: как Hadoop меняет правила игры
С появлением Hadoop мир анализа больших данных претерпел революционные изменения. Эта мощная экосистема предоставила разработчикам инструменты для работы с объемами информации, которые ранее казались непостижимыми. Разработчики Hadoop теперь стоят в авангарде борьбы за ценные инсайты, извлекаемые из моря данных, и их способности востребованы как никогда.
Вот несколько ключевых аспектов, которые Hadoop привнес в проекты с Big Data:
- Масштабируемость: Hadoop позволяет обрабатывать петабайты данных благодаря своей распределенной архитектуре.
- Гибкость: Разработчики могут легко интегрировать Hadoop с различными источниками данных и обрабатывать их разнообразные форматы.
- Экономичность: Снижение стоимости хранения и обработки данных делает Hadoop доступным для компаний различного масштаба.
- Отказоустойчивость: Автоматическое восстановление данных после сбоя одного из узлов сети уменьшает риски потери информации.
Навык | Востребованность | Средняя ЗП (USD) |
---|---|---|
Hadoop | Высокая | 120,000 |
Apache Spark | Средняя | 115,000 |
Data Mining | Высокая | 110,000 |
Рынок труда активно откликается на потребности в специалистах по работе с Big Data, и вакансии разработчика Hadoop на платформе Hired подтверждают этот тренд. Специалисты, владеющие навыками работы с Hadoop, Apache Spark, и другими технологиями обработки больших данных, могут рассчитывать на привлекательные предложения от работодателей, стремящихся использовать потенциал Big Data для роста своего бизнеса.
Интервью с экспертом: что ждут работодатели от Hadoop-разработчиков
В современном мире больших данных, специалисты, владеющие Hadoop, становятся ключевыми игроками на рынке труда. Опираясь на мнения ведущих экспертов в области аналитики и обработки данных, мы выяснили, что работодатели ожидают от Hadoop-разработчиков не только глубоких технических знаний, но и способности к решению сложных бизнес-задач. Вот несколько ключевых навыков, которые должен иметь каждый специалист:
- Профессиональное владение Java: Поскольку Hadoop написан на Java, знание этого языка программирования является обязательным.
- Понимание экосистемы Hadoop: Включая компоненты как HDFS, MapReduce, Hive и Pig.
- Опыт работы с NoSQL базами данных: Например, с HBase, Cassandra или MongoDB.
- Знание Linux: Так как большинство Hadoop-кластеров работают на Linux, важно уметь навигировать в этой ОС.
Кроме технических умений, важны и личностные качества. Работодатели ищут кандидатов, способных к критическому мышлению и решению проблем, а также обладающих хорошими коммуникативными навыками для взаимодействия с командой и клиентами. Ниже представлена таблица с основными качествами, которые ценятся работодателями:
Технические навыки | Личностные качества |
---|---|
Знание Java и экосистемы Hadoop | Критическое мышление |
Опыт с NoSQL базами данных | Коммуникативные навыки |
Понимание принципов распределенных систем | Способность к обучению и развитию |
Умение работать в Linux | Командная работа |
Карьерный рост в сфере Big Data: перспективы и возможности
В мире, где объемы данных растут с каждым днем, специалисты в области Big Data становятся ключевыми игроками на рынке труда. Hadoop Developer – это профессия, которая открывает широкие горизонты для тех, кто хочет работать с большими данными. Эти специалисты занимаются разработкой, поддержкой и оптимизацией Hadoop-приложений, что требует глубоких знаний в области программирования, системного анализа и, конечно, работы с данными.
Перспективы карьерного роста для Hadoop-разработчиков многообещающи. Вот несколько направлений, которые могут рассмотреть специалисты, стремящиеся к развитию в этой сфере:
- Архитектор Big Data – проектирование сложных систем для работы с большими данными.
- Data Scientist – анализ больших объемов данных для выявления закономерностей и тенденций.
- Менеджер проектов в области Big Data – управление проектами и командами, работающими с большими данными.
Должность | Средняя зарплата в год (USD) | Требуемые навыки |
---|---|---|
Hadoop Developer | 120,000 | Java, Hadoop, MapReduce, HDFS |
Big Data Architect | 150,000 | Big Data Technologies, Data Modeling, System Design |
Data Scientist | 130,000 | Machine Learning, Statistical Analysis, Python |
Работа в сфере Big Data не только обещает хорошее вознаграждение, но и предлагает возможность работать на переднем крае технологического прогресса. Специалисты, которые постоянно совершенствуют свои навыки и адаптируются к новым технологиям, всегда будут востребованы на рынке труда.
Советы по подготовке к собеседованию для работы с Hadoop
Стремитесь стать разработчиком Hadoop и хотите пройти собеседование с успехом? Вот несколько ключевых моментов, которые помогут вам подготовиться и выделиться среди конкурентов. Прежде всего, убедитесь, что вы хорошо знакомы с экосистемой Hadoop, включая основные компоненты, такие как HDFS, MapReduce, и YARN. Кроме того, не забудьте изучить дополнительные инструменты, такие как Hive, Pig и Apache Spark.
Ваши знания и навыки должны включать:
- Понимание принципов распределенной обработки данных.
- Опыт работы с большими данными и способность оптимизировать производительность задач.
- Знание языков программирования, таких как Java, Scala или Python.
Практика — ключ к успеху. Попробуйте решить реальные задачи, используя Hadoop и связанные с ним инструменты. Это не только улучшит ваши технические навыки, но и даст вам уверенность во время технического интервью. Кроме того, не забывайте о мягких навыках: способность четко и ясно излагать свои мысли будет неоценимым активом при обсуждении технических решений.
Вот пример таблицы с некоторыми темами, которые могут быть полезны при подготовке к собеседованию:
Тема | Что изучить |
---|---|
Основы Hadoop | Архитектура HDFS, MapReduce, YARN |
Экосистема Hadoop | Hive, Pig, HBase, ZooKeeper |
Распределенные вычисления | Паттерны проектирования, оптимизация производительности |
Программирование | Java для Hadoop, использование API |
Не забывайте также ознакомиться с последними тенденциями в области больших данных и следить за обновлениями в экосистеме Hadoop. Это покажет вашу заинтересованность и готовность к непрерывному обучению, что является важным качеством для специалиста в области больших данных.
Вопрос/ответ
**Вопрос**: Какова основная роль разработчика Hadoop на рынке труда сегодня?
**Ответ**: Разработчик Hadoop – это специалист, который занимается проектированием, разработкой и поддержкой систем обработки больших данных. Он использует экосистему Hadoop для решения задач, связанных с хранением, обработкой и анализом огромных объемов неструктурированных данных.
**Вопрос**: Почему спрос на разработчиков Hadoop продолжает расти?
**Ответ**: В эпоху цифровизации данные становятся новым «нефтью», а значит, специалисты, умеющие работать с большими данными, особенно востребованы. Hadoop является одной из ведущих платформ для работы с Big Data, и поэтому разработчики, владеющие этой технологией, пользуются большим спросом.
**Вопрос**: Какие навыки необходимы для работы разработчика Hadoop?
**Ответ**: Для успешной работы разработчика Hadoop требуются глубокие знания Java, понимание принципов распределенных систем, опыт работы с HDFS, MapReduce, Hive, Pig и другими компонентами экосистемы Hadoop. Также важны навыки работы с базами данных и SQL, а также знание скриптовых языков, например, Python или Scala.
**Вопрос**: Какие отрасли активно ищут разработчиков Hadoop?
**Ответ**: Разработчики Hadoop востребованы в самых разных отраслях, включая финансы, здравоохранение, розничную торговлю, телекоммуникации и многие другие. Везде, где есть потребность в обработке и анализе больших объемов данных, там нужны специалисты по Hadoop.
**Вопрос**: Какие перспективы карьерного роста открываются перед разработчиками Hadoop?
**Ответ**: Разработчики Hadoop могут рассчитывать на рост до позиций архитекторов больших данных, руководителей проектов в области данных и аналитиков данных. Также они могут специализироваться на определенных компонентах экосистемы Hadoop или расширять свои знания в смежных областях, таких как машинное обучение и искусственный интеллект.
**Вопрос**: Где можно найти вакансии для разработчиков Hadoop?
**Ответ**: Вакансии для разработчиков Hadoop можно найти на специализированных платформах для поиска работы в области IT, таких как Hired, а также на общих сайтах по трудоустройству, профессиональных сообществах и форумах, связанных с Big Data.
Вывод
В заключение, спрос на разработчиков Hadoop продолжает расти, поскольку компании всех размеров и отраслей стремятся извлечь максимальную пользу из своих массивных наборов данных. Платформа Hired предоставляет уникальную возможность для талантливых специалистов в области больших данных найти работу своей мечты и внести свой вклад в развитие технологий обработки данных. Если вы обладаете необходимыми навыками и готовы принять вызовы, связанные с работой разработчика Hadoop, то ваш интеллект и умение работать с большими данными могут стать ключевыми для успеха в этой динамично развивающейся сфере. Присоединяйтесь к сообществу Hired и станьте частью команды, которая формирует будущее цифровой эры, где каждый байт имеет значение, а каждый разработчик может внести свой весомый вклад в мир больших данных.